This ones definitely the biggest question since the answer influences both the true fate of the Half-Face Man and the real identity of Missy. But apart from it being filmed in the same location as the garden scenes from The Girl Who Waited (2011), all we know about this place is that (according to Missy), it is Heaven. Until proven wrong, were calling bull on this one. Doctor Who never does the afterlife. As far as Russell T. Davies was concerned, in the Whoniverse there is no heaven or hell. Just blackness. And Steven Moffat seems to be following this train of thought, with the Doctor slamming down the Half-Face Mans pursuit of the Promised Land as a delusion brought on by stuffing so much humanity into himself. So if it isnt Heaven, the question remains of just what this place is. Given the presence of Missy and the Cybermen in the series finale, the most likely answer is that it somehow ties into the Cybermens plans. Perhaps being a false paradise that robots from across the universe are being drawn to, Then again, since both the Doctor and Moffat lie, it could just as easily be the Whoniverse's version of the afterlife that inspired various religions much like the reveal that the Beast in Series 2 influenced the Christian image of Satan.
